Thorazine (Chlorpromazine Injection) Information

WebDec 1, 2024 · Chlorpromazine hydrochloride injection, USP is a clear, slightly yellow colored solution intended for deep intramuscular use. Each mL contains Chlorpromazine hydrochloride USP 25 mg, ascorbic acid 2 mg, sodium metabisulfite 1 mg, sodium sulfite 1 mg and sodium chloride 6 mg in Water for Injection. pH is between 3.4 to 5.4. WebSep 1, 2024 · Chlorpromazine (thorazine ®) Low Potency. ... initiate at lower doses and titrate as needed. Usual dose: 200 mg/day. Some patients may require 1-2 g/day. IM, IV: Initial: 25 mg, may repeat (25-50 mg) in 1-4 hours - gradually increase to a maximum of 400 mg/dose every 4-6 hours until patient is controlled.
